Macy's

Macy's, an American department store chain is well-known for its flagship store located at Herald Square. It is one of the largest in the United States. It offers a wide variety of merchandise, including clothing footwear, shoes, accessories, cosmetics, and household goods. In addition to its main store, the company operates a number of other locations throughout the country.

In the 1800s, Rowland Hussey Macy founded a department store in New York City. Macy is credited with a number of innovations that have shaped the modern department store as we see it today, such as using cash only and establishing a system of one-price shopping. He also standardized newspaper pricing in the US and was among the first to offer money-back guarantees. He also invented a made to measure clothing operation and the Christmas window display that is still a Macy's tradition today.
